Prepend the salt to the password and hash it with a standard password hashing function like argon2, bcrypt, scrypt, or pbkdf2. As of 2017, nist recommends using a secret input when storing memorized secrets such as passwords a pepper performs a comparable role to a salt, but while a salt is not secret merely unique and can be stored alongside the hashed output, a. By making fine hash you have become part of a tradition that dates back into prehistory. In cryptography, a pepper is a secret added to an input such as a password prior to being hashed with a cryptographic hash function. It is usually administered by taking the small metal capsules used in the old fashioned whip cream canisters and piercing the top with a cracker paraphenelia used for this exact purpose as no one making sundaes uses a cracker and allowing all the gas to fill a large balloon. With all of its punchy spices leaching out when fried, chorizo adds a strong depth of flavour to any recipe. Jun 26, 2008 eben brooks performs hippie jacks unsmokeable hash, a parody of the poxy boggards happy jacks undrinkable ale, at lestats coffeehouse in san diego, ca on june 21st, 2008. Before going into salt, we need to understand why we require strong hashing at the first place so according to naked security, 55% of the users uses the same.
The ingredients serves 4 500g of potatoes skin on or off, depending on preference 200g chorizo 1 medium onion, finely chopped. How to guide for cracking password hashes with hashcat. Building off of and slightly modifying the original tenets, the hippie hash also called. Im storing the salted hash of a credit card number in a database. Feb 14, 2016 prepend the salt to the password and hash it with a standard password hashing function like argon2, bcrypt, scrypt, or pbkdf2. Online hash crack is an online service that attempts to recover your lost passwords. How to crack hashes m d5md5 hashes are easily broken in the present day due to the prevalence of online md5 crackers such as however if you cant crack your hash online then you will need to use a tool such as john the ripper or more advanced hash crackers such as password pro or hashcat. A detoxifying, luxurious blend of therapeutic salts and essential oils combine to create a deeply relaxing, beautiful hydrotherapy treatment. Secure salted password hashing how to do it properly. Stir so they are evenly coated with oil and stir in spices salt, pepper, thyme, italian seasoning while the potatoes cook wash and cut the green beans into 1. Can you help me understand what a cryptographic salt is. As of 2017, nist recommends using a secret input when storing memorized secrets such as passwords. Even though this recipe is quite specific, you can cut the potatoes and chorizo anyway you wish to.
You can crack the eggs straight into the pan or serve poached eggs over the hash for those extra runny yolks. For example, i will place the first half of the salt before the saltedhash of the password, and the last half of the salt after the saltedhash of the password. S alted md5 used in a large amount of applications to increase hash parity and to increase the time it takes to crack. This makes it easier to attack multiple users by cracking only one hash. It is actually determining how to manipulate your password before hashing it. Eben brooks performs hippie jacks unsmokeable hash, a parody of the poxy boggards happy jacks undrinkable ale, at lestats coffeehouse in san diego, ca on june 21st, 2008. How the fleetwood diner makes its famous hippie hash. I hadnt until a couple weeks back and have had a vat literally in my fridge since.
A salt is simply added to make a password hash output unique even for users adopting common passwords. Md5, ntlm, wordpress, wifi wpa handshakes office encrypted files word, excel, apple itunes backup zip rar 7zip archive pdf documents. If your pot products are intended for crossborder travel then turning your buds into hash is a smart way to maximize your smuggling efforts. Crackstation online password hash cracking md5, sha1. It is capable of attacking every hash function supported by phps hash function, as well as md5md5, lm, ntlm, mysql 4. Hash, sha1, sha256, whirlpool, ripemd, crc32 optional salt. Using a long salt ensures that a rainbow table for a database would be prohibitively large. When they login you retrieve their hashed password and their salt, you then rehash the password they supplied in the password box with the salt you retrieved from the database, and see if that matches the hashed password you retrieved from the. Mar 14, 20 i learned about hippie hash after my friend stephanie whipped some up and brought it to a girls dinner with a breakfast for dinner theme.
For example, if an attacker hashes the value letmein it will generate the same value as the one stored in the backend system for another user with the password letmein. In addition, you are specifying hash mode 0, which does not use a salt to begin with. The application is aware of this design so can fetch this data, and obtain the salt and saltedpassword hash. Im not sure where the dish originated, but i think the village kitchen makes better hippie hash. If we make it generic, and the length is known to be 32 or more, then the mode must be implemented with a second transformation. When hot, add onion, salt, and pepper, sauteing until translucent. If one wants to summarize our knowledge of physics in the briefest possible terms, there are three really fundamental observations.
I finally tried the infamous hash a few months ago, and it was bland and soggy with grease. Hippie crack is our homegrown granola, cooked fresh right in our kitchen. In cryptography, a salt is random data that is used as an additional input to a oneway function that hashes data, a password or passphrase. As a rule of thumb, make your salt is at least as long as the hash functions output. I always store the salt mixed in with the saltedpassword hash. Through the collaborative efforts of many of your fellow hashers, a new perspective on hashing has been born. There were, in total, deaths in england and wales between 1993 and 20 in which nitrous oxide has been mentioned on the death certificate. Crackstation uses massive precomputed lookup tables to crack password hashes. And if an attacker is able to obtain that information wouldnt they still be able to crack the password or is it more they would need to do it over and over for each user. Retrieve the users salt and hash from the database. Salted password hashing doing it right codeproject. Assuming the salt is very long, not knowing the salt would make it nearly impossible to crack due to the additional length that the salt adds to the password, but you still have to brute force even if you do know the salt.
Salts are typically stored along with the the final hash because theres no need to protect them. Simply the fact that each hash has its own unique salt value makes pre. Mar 08, 20 the fleetwood is a great diner, and there are lots of fantastic reasons to eat there, but in my opion, the hippie hash aint one of them. What id like to be able to do is determine if two different entries in the same database correspond to the same credit card. If a salt is too short, it will be easy for an attacker to create a rainbow table consisting of every possible salt appended to every likely password.
All the above mentioned mechanisms to crack a hash are possible because each time a plaintext string is hashed, it generates the exact same hashed value. Its purpose is to make precomputation based attacks unhelpful. Hash can be smoked, eaten and even taken as a suppository if you are so inclined. These hashes are easily identified by the following factors they consist of two blocks connected by a colon, the first is the hash the second is the salt. How do i go about cracking a wordpress hash the salted kind if i have the salt thats given to me from the config file. This is the real key to the salt from what i understand, because to crack every account i have to reinvent the wheel so to speak for each one.
Sep 02, 2016 whole30 hippie hash recipe this hippie hash, inspired by a diner in ann arbor, is packed full of goodforyou veggies and couldnt be easier to make. These tables store a mapping between the hash of a password, and the correct password for that hash. If the hash is present in the database, the password can be. What does it mean to salt, pepper, and hash a password. The following is a php script for running dictionary attacks against both salted and unsalted password hashes. These days most websites and applications use salt based md5 hash generation to prevent it from being cracked easily using precomputed hash tables such as rainbow crack.
Now if i know how to apply the correct salt to a password to generate the hash, id do it because a salt really just extends the lengthcomplexity of the hashed phrase. Command line is fairly straight forword, here are the options. Using a salt will not prepend characters to your string. This is what you need to know about hippy crack, and why it. The hippie hash welcomes minors if parentguardian is present. Indulge in the restorative ritual of the bath a time to breathe deeply, reflect, soften, and cleanse the b. Historically a password was stored in plaintext on a system, but over time additional safeguards developed to protect a users password against being read from the system. It supportes several hash formats with options like a numbers bruteforce and verbose mode. What to use as a salt the sql server hashbytes function if youre not familiar with what the salt is when it comes to cryptographic functions, its basically something added to whatever were trying to encrypt to make it harder to decrypt the data two way functions, like symmetric and asymmetric key functions or find a collision one way. As i understand it, without a salt you can use a rainbow table to do an o1 lookup of a hash. Such a simple yet satisfying dish, great for a late breakfast, brunch or even a quick snack to tie you over until dinner time. Whole30 hippie hash recipe this hippie hash, inspired by a diner in ann arbor, is packed full of goodforyou veggies and couldnt be easier to make.
Create a rainbow table for salted hashes with various salts and then do a simple select statement over the table to select the correct hash anyway. Save both the salt and the hash in the users database record. Salt can be used with hashed strings to make a rainbow table attack probably impossible. It is usually administered by taking the small metal capsules used in the old fashioned whip cream canisters and piercing the top with a cracker paraphenelia used for this exact purpose as no one making sundaes uses a cracker and allowing all the gas to fill a large. Minors are free, as it is presumed they will not drink and their food is included. How to guide for cracking password hashes with hashcat using.
By adding pepper you increase the problem space in a cryptographically random way, rendering the problem intractable without serious hardware. What is a salt and how does it make password hashing more secure. Been lurking but could not find the answer to this. Mar 07, 20 ann arbors fleetwood diner has served up this favorite to residents and university of michigan students for decades. A salt is a random string or really collection of bytes unique to each stored hash. The salt should be stored in the user account table alongside the hash. Cryptography stack exchange is a question and answer site for software developers, mathematicians and others interested in cryptography. Ann arbors fleetwood diner has served up this favorite to residents and university of michigan students for decades.
For example, i will place the first half of the salt before the salted hash of the password, and the last half of the salt after the salted hash of the password. No need to feel guilty eating it straight from the bag, offered in 7oz and 16oz. What is a salt and how does it make password hashing more. As an example, lets say that the password is secret and the salt is 535743. I get how hash salting working at a very basic level but i dont get how the hash get unsalted and where the information needed to do so is stored. The hash values are indexed so that it is possible to quickly search the database for a given hash. The fleetwood is a great diner, and there are lots of fantastic reasons to eat there, but in my opion, the hippie hash aint one of them. Prepend the salt to the given password and hash it using the same hash function. Md5 salted hash kracker is the free tool to crack and recover your lost password from the salted md5 hash. Like any good hash, it starts with potatoes and onions that are cooked in olive oil with some garlic. If your password is stored with a unique salt then any precomputed passwordhash table targeting unsalted password hashes or targeting an account with a different salt will not. A hacker with access to the hash output and the salt can theoretically brute force guess an input which will generate the hash and therefore pass validation in the password textbox.
287 1147 1483 619 280 523 1572 808 733 338 252 437 13 1394 1486 356 1133 1251 1355 683 994 513 870 1541 1583 31 545 327 1454 781 1394 1446 325 1311 222 551 1052 1334 1343 1164